Species Pseudomonas bauzanensis

Name: Pseudomonas bauzanensis Zhang et al. 2011

Category: Species

Proposed as: sp. nov.

Etymology: bau.za.nen’sis. M.L. masc./fem. adj. bauzanensis, of or belonging to Bauzanum medieval Latin name of Bozen/Bolzano, a city in South Tyrol, Italy, where the species was first isolated

Gender: feminine

Type strain: BZ93; CGMCC 1.9095; DSM 22558; LMG 26048

16S rRNA gene: GQ161991 Analyse FASTA

Valid publication: Zhang DC, Liu HC, Zhou YG, Schinner F, Margesin R. Pseudomonas bauzanensis sp. nov., isolated from soil.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2011; 61:2333-2337.

IJSEM list: Euzeby JP.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 61, part 10 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2012; 62:5-6.

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P

Taxonomic status: synonym

Correct name: Halopseudomonas bauzanensis (Zhang et al. 2011) Rudra and Gupta 2021

Risk group: 1

Parent taxon: Pseudomonas Migula 1894 (Approved Lists 1980)
